Pesquisa no site
Itens ativos
Posts mais lidos hoje
Login do usuário
Assine o RSS do Drupal-BR
Aplicação que grava informações em um banco de dados
Preciso escrever um site, que na realidade é uma aplicação completa. Como a aplicação por si só já é bem complexa, resolvi tentar o Drupal.
O problema é que preciso criar várias tabelas em um banco de dados, e atualizá-las pelo próprio site, ou seja, cadastro de clientes com perfis diferentes, gerenciamento dos dados, filtragem de dados dependendo do tipo de cliente, armazenamento de arquivos no banco de dados (não como arquivos, mas como binarios na propria tabela do banco), inúmeros controles que serão feitos no banco de dados, pagamento online, controle de acesso dependendo do pagamento ter sido ou não efetuado, etc. O site tem que ser auto-suficiente, funcionar sozinho sem a intervenção de ninguém, a não ser uma manutenção semanal.
Existe alguma forma simples de fazer isso no Drupal, sem ter que escrever o código todo em php em uma "Page", ou mesmo ainda um módulo que possa me ajudar? Sem ser o CCK, senão terei que praticamente aprender uma linguagem nova pra isso, o que eu não teria tempo.
Alguém poderia me ajudar?
Obrigado.
- Se logue ou se registre para poder enviar comentários
- 325 leituras


O Drupal é uma aplicação completa e já cria automaticamente todas as tabelas necessárias. Os módulos adicionais que usam registro em banco de dados também cria as tabelas automaticamente, na instalação dos mesmos.
Acho que antes, precisa entender um pouco mais sobre o que é CMS.
Forma simples de fazer tudo isso aí que falou, acredito que não exista. Da mesma forma, acredito que com Drupal será muito mais fácil, prático e rápido.
Particularmente, a única vez que precisei escrever algum código foi em uma linha, alterando um módulo (guestbook). Mas tem quem prefira fazer seus próprios módulos.
Outra coisa: sem CCK e Views dá pra fazer bastante coisa e ao mesmo tempo quase nada, dependendo do que espera do resultado final. Com certeza você vai precisar aprender e estudar uma linguagem nova, gastar tempo e dedicação. Não linguagem de programação. Linguagem de operação, se é que pode dizer assim.
No que a comunidade puder ajudar, tenho certeza que o fará.
Abraço!
Leonardo Silva
Produtor Cultural
Desenvolvedor Web